The thing that always worries me about cloud systems are the hidden dependencies in your cloud provider that work until they don't. They typically don't output logs and metrics, so you have no choice to pray that someone looks at your support ticket and clicks their internal system's "fix it for this customer" button.

I'll also say that I'm interested in ubiquitous mTLS so that you don't have to isolate teams with VPCs and opaque proxies. I don't think we have widely-available technology around yet that eliminates the need for what Slack seems to have here, but trusting the network has always seemed like a bad idea to me, and this shows how a workaround can go wrong. (Of course, to avoid issues like the confused deputy problem, which Slack suffered from, you need some service to issue certs to applications as they scale up that will be accepted by services that it is allowed to talk to and rejected by all other services. In that case, this postmortem would have said "we scaled up our web frontends, but the service that issues them certificates to talk to the backend exploded in a big ball of fire, so we were down." Ya just can't win ;)

Experienced something similar with mongo atlas today. Our primary node went down and the cluster didn’t failover to either of the secondaries. We got to sit with our production environment completely offline while staring at two completely functional nodes that we had no ability to use. Even when we managed to get hold of support they also seemed unable to trigger a failover and basically told us to wait for the primary node to come back up. It took 90 minutes in the end and has definitely made us rethink about the future and the control we’ve given over.
Some customers have a hard requirement that their slack instances be behind a unique VPC. Other customers are easier to sell to if you sprinkle some “you’ll get your own closed network” on top of the offer, if security is something they’ve been burned by in the past.

I agree with you the mTLS is the future. It exists within many companies internally (as a VPC alternative!) and works great. There’s some problems around the certificate issuer being a central point of failure, but these are known problems with well-understood solutions.

I think there’s mostly a non-technical barrier to be overcome here, where the non-technical executives need to understand that closed network != better security. mTLS’s time in the sun will only come when the aforementioned sales pitch is less effective (or even counterproductive!) for Enterprise Inc., I think.
